Hello everyone,
I have a Webi report that contains a filter on Company Code. On the BW Query that populates the report, this object if filtered by an authorization variable (so user only see their respective entities).
The Webi report runs correctly and will prompt the user to select a company code from this generated list (as expected). However I've noticed that Webi will then use the TEXT and not KEY to do the filtering. So if you have 2 values with the same description, and you select 1 of those, the WEBI report will then select both entries, even if the keys are different.
Is there a way to tell WEBI to use the key, and not description? You can't use the KEY object to create the WEBI filter, as it's a detail object. I also looked at the properties and there's nothing there.

Hi Rudy,
This is a product limitation in BI 4. There is a Fix Request raised for it that appears to have been addressed by Problem Report ID ADAPT01634236 in Critical Patch 2.18 (released yesterday)
It's also not an issue in SP04 (released last week).
This is documented in KBA 1714252.

oh - my mistake, this one is in regards to not letting you select multiple objects with the same description but different keys via the WebI web viewer.
KBA 1694402 is what you're describing with it returning all values based on the same description:
https://bosap-support.wdf.sap.corp/sap/support/notes/1694402
This is fixed in Patch 2.16 & SP04.
